Generally in cases such as yours, where liposuction is being performed in different areas of the body including arms, it is recommended to have someone with you 24 hours post surgery. You may have some discomfort immediately post-op and will need someone to assist you with small things. Also depending the type of anesthesia being used, this can be a factor whether you will need to have someone with you the day of your procedure. It's always better to be on the safe side regardless of how big or small you think the procedure may be. Upon consulting a Board Certified Plastic Surgeon, your physician will be able confirm how much liposuction will be performed and what anesthesia will be used in order to provide you the proper post surgical instructions. For my hi definition procedures and any type of liposuction I do not allow patients to be alone the first 24-72 hours as you can get vasovagal due to fluid shifting and pass out very easily. Especially if you take the garment on / off to quickly. I suggest formal post operative care. Best, Dr. Emer.
You should have a reliable caretaker for at least 24-48 hours after the surgery. The post-op instructions should be given at the pre-op appointment. Make sure you discuss it with your Board Certified PS
If you are having general anesthesia or twilight sedation, you should absolutely have someone nearby who can help you up in case you are dizzy or fall and who can help you monitor your use of pain medication. If you don't have anyone, there are agencies that can send A medical assistant or a nurse. They have reasonable prices and can even arrange rides. If your procedure is for small volumes and is done without anesthesia, you may be just fine on your own. The best thing todo is to check with your doctor. When it comes to safety, you are better off being safe than sorry.

For any person that has had general anesthesia, it is recommended that you not be alone for the first night. For even longer than that, you might benefit from someone close by to help you with all the tasks we take for granted.
I always have my patients go home with someone after surgery, and prefer that they have someone stay with them for the first 24 hours. This is for safety reasons.
You should have someone with you during the first 24 hours after this surgery, especially if it is done under general anethesia or sedation. It is helpful to have help moving around.
No. It is important to have a responsible adult for at least the first night. Many patients can experience lightheadedness/fainting/nausea etc and may require help.Suppose you stand up, feel lightheaded and fall and hit your head on furniture?You need someone there.
I insist that all my patients having general or sedation have someone with them for the first 24 hours. This is to make sure they take their medications appropriately and are helped to the bathroom. If a friend can't be there then I would definitely ask your surgeon if they have an agency or person they use to take care of you.
